Uneven pavement repair services focus on fixing surfaces where the pavement has become irregular or bumpy. This process typically involves assessing the damaged area, removing loose or damaged material, and then leveling or replacing sections to restore a smooth, even surface. The goal is to eliminate hazards caused by uneven surfaces, such as tripping risks or vehicle damage, while improving the overall appearance and functionality of the pavement.
These repair services help address common problems like cracks, potholes, and heaving pavement that can develop over time due to weather, ground movement, or heavy traffic. Left unaddressed, these issues can worsen, leading to more costly repairs or safety concerns. Repairing uneven pavement helps prevent further deterioration, enhances safety for pedestrians and vehicles, and extends the lifespan of the paved surface.

Discover typical Uneven Pavement Repair project ranges for New London, NH.
Per Square Foot Costs - Repairing uneven pavement typically ranges from $3 to $10 per square foot, depending on the extent of the damage. For example, a small section in New London, NH might cost around $150, while larger areas could reach $1,000 or more.
Patch Repair Expenses - Patching small potholes or cracks generally falls between $100 and $300 per repair. Larger patches or extensive repairs in nearby areas may cost $500 or higher, based on size and complexity.
Full-Depth Rebuilding - Complete resurfacing or rebuilding of uneven pavement can range from $8 to $15 per square foot. For a driveway in the New London region, this might total between $2,000 and $5,000 depending on size and materials used.
Project-Based Pricing - Some contractors offer project-based estimates, which can vary widely from $1,000 to over $10,000 for extensive repairs. Costs depend on factors such as pavement condition, location, and specific repair needs.

Asphalt Patching services address uneven pavement caused by cracks, potholes, and surface deterioration, helping to restore a smooth driving surface. Local contractors can assess and repair damaged areas to improve safety and appearance.
Concrete Leveling solutions focus on correcting uneven concrete slabs, including driveways and walkways, to prevent tripping hazards and maintain structural integrity. Skilled service providers can lift and stabilize sunken concrete surfaces.
Pothole Repair specialists work on filling and sealing potholes that contribute to uneven pavement surfaces, ensuring a safer and more even roadway or sidewalk. Experienced pros can perform quick and durable repairs.
Surface Resurfacing services involve applying new layers of asphalt or concrete to improve the appearance and uniformity of existing pavement. Local providers can help extend the lifespan of pavement surfaces through proper resurfacing techniques.
Crack Sealing services prevent further pavement deterioration by sealing cracks that can lead to uneven surfaces and water damage. Professionals can identify and properly seal cracks to maintain pavement integrity.
Slope and Drainage Correction services focus on adjusting pavement grades to improve water runoff and prevent pooling that causes uneven surfaces. Local specialists can evaluate and modify slopes to enhance pavement longevity.
What causes uneven pavement? Uneven pavement can result from soil movement, poor installation, or weather-related factors that lead to shifting or settling of the surface.
How can uneven pavement be repaired? Local pavement repair professionals typically use leveling, grinding, or filling techniques to restore a smooth surface.
Is uneven pavement dangerous? Yes, it can pose tripping hazards and cause damage to vehicles or equipment if not addressed.
How long does pavement repair usually take? Repair times vary depending on the extent of the damage but are generally completed within a few hours to a day.
